In the run up to this year's Draper's Awards on 17th November, we are investing the accomplishments of all four retailers who have been shortlisted for the Corporate Social Responsibility Award. This week, we're looking at how F&F are attempting challenge ethical issues within the fashion industry.

F&F, Tesco’s own clothing brand are aiming to reduce both their social and environmental impact. They are determined to confront challenges surrounding ethics throughout the fashion industry. In order to achieve this goal, F&F have a number of core beliefs. These include continuously monitoring and reducing their environmental impact and building partnerships with suppliers.

F&F’s You Buy One, We Donate One range of children’s school uniforms sees one school uniform donated to a child in Sir Lanka, Bangladesh or Kenya for every one bought in store. This has resulted in a massive 350,000 uniforms being donated since 2009. Despite this phenomenal feat, this is not the end to F&F’s educational endeavours as they have also created F&F Funding Futures, who work to increase lives and potential through education. This extends to many other set-ups aimed at improving lives across the world.

Global sourcing is essential for an international retailer. F&F are part of the Better Cotton Fast Track Programme, who aim to have 30% of the world’s global cotton market producing cotton in a more sustainable way. To contribute to this, F&F are working towards 100% of their cotton being produced in a way that will have minimal environmental impact and achieve the best possible deal for those who are producing it. They are also involved in reducing deforestation and checking that all fur products only contain fake fur.
